Haven't seen this test on WrongPlanet before, but it is used to measure sub-clinical autism traits that tend to appear in the relatives of those diagnosed with autism.

Broad Autism Phenotype Test

My scores: 94 aloof, 97 rigid, and 82 pragmatic

"You scored above the cutoff on all three scales. Clearly, you are either autistic or on the broader autistic phenotype. You probably are not very social, and when you do interact with others, you come off as strange or rude without meaning to. You probably also like things to be familiar and predictable and don't like changes, especially unexpected ones."

These are my results:

Rigid & Language

You scored 82 aloof, 117 rigid and 96 pragmatic

You score above the cutoff for both rigid personality and pragmatic communication differences. You probably don't really like changes, especially unexpected ones. You may have a daily routine that you seldom vary, dislike going to unfamiliar places or meeting new people, or have specific rules about how you do things which you refuse to change. In addition, you likely have trouble with communication, which is probably more evident in informal, social settings than in more formalized settings where the expectations are explicitly stated. However, you are apparently just as interested, if not more, in interacting with other people. You may be either on the broader autistic phenotype, or in fact autistic.Your Analysis (Vertical line = Average)
